Output ffd5d767bd1979cdda178509b16cc2bb88341eaede80b544bd6eab6b658b1c0c:0

value
9172106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ca14da28c04c27e8a140f214867606368640c428 OP_EQUAL
address
3L7XQ8R5duE71f1ALGRKShpdRddtAPmW9L
transaction
ffd5d767bd1979cdda178509b16cc2bb88341eaede80b544bd6eab6b658b1c0c
confirmations
247085
spent
true